Output cfb94d33222d1b1f9836a5a2376e74ac19ee39ea144adeae21a32d82542a12fd:0

value
37440000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e44d100a663c52391e56aef93a2400dda8a5be54 OP_EQUAL
address
3NWAJgtK6iUwdv5yuR6ntFhQQtNvYrJciY
transaction
cfb94d33222d1b1f9836a5a2376e74ac19ee39ea144adeae21a32d82542a12fd
confirmations
415881
spent
true